Transaction fd38851696a4b73baa1d51a5426d75d4a69f654d017a95fa627041aac2d69379
1 Input
1 Output
-
fd38851696a4b73baa1d51a5426d75d4a69f654d017a95fa627041aac2d69379:0
- value
- 3493649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68bcc7104fdc3c07d0939742b21302c0276df872 OP_EQUAL
- address
- 3BEpLzSf9miueYzJtEpKjDVujKLfU73AdP